Iwan von Wartburg is a scholar working on Strategy and Management, Economics and Econometrics and Management of Technology and Innovation. According to data from OpenAlex, Iwan von Wartburg has authored 6 papers receiving a total of 445 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 3 papers in Strategy and Management, 3 papers in Economics and Econometrics and 2 papers in Management of Technology and Innovation. Recurrent topics in Iwan von Wartburg’s work include Innovation and Knowledge Management (3 papers), Innovation Policy and R&D (3 papers) and Intellectual Property and Patents (2 papers). Iwan von Wartburg is often cited by papers focused on Innovation and Knowledge Management (3 papers), Innovation Policy and R&D (3 papers) and Intellectual Property and Patents (2 papers). Iwan von Wartburg collaborates with scholars based in Germany and Switzerland. Iwan von Wartburg's co-authors include Thorsten Teichert, Katja Rost, Edlira Shehu and Christopher Lettl and has published in prestigious journals such as Research Policy, Transportation Research Part A Policy and Practice and Business Horizons.
